Desktop monitor shipments reached 133.4 million units in 2025, up 4.3% year-on-year, indicating a recovery from post-pandemic disruptions. The growth also reflects how monitors are increasingly evolving into versatile, high-value tools for laptop-dominated environments, with gaming helping drive demand for higher-performance displays.
Global gaming monitor shipments rose to 41 million units in 2025, up 50.2% year-on-year. Gaming monitors accounted for 31.1% of total desktop monitor shipments. In 4Q25, gaming monitor shipments increased for the eleventh consecutive quarter and reached the highest level since Omdia began tracking the category.
Omdia said the gaming segment is expanding faster than the conventional monitor market, establishing gaming monitors as a key growth driver. Momentum is being supported by added value and enhanced functionality, including rapid adoption of models with refresh rates above 120 Hz, along with improvements in responsiveness and screen size aligned with modern gaming requirements.
“Gaming monitors are expected to keep pace with the evolution of CPUs/GPUs and the increasing performance demands of gaming content,” said Hidetoshi Himuro, Senior Principal Analyst at Omdia.
Himuro also pointed to a relationship between GPU upgrades and monitor refresh-rate trends, noting that when NVIDIA’s RTX50 series graphics cards enter the market, higher-refresh-rate gaming monitors tend to follow.
The gaming monitor market is also diversifying across product tiers. OLED-equipped gaming monitors—led by Samsung’s QD-OLED and LG’s WOLED—are gaining share due to perfect black levels and fast response times that improve visual fidelity and responsiveness compared with LCDs. However, high manufacturing costs keep most OLED offerings in the premium segment.
At the same time, improved specifications at lower price points and models using previous-generation technologies are addressing the needs of lightweight and first-time gamers. Omdia said this combination—premium innovation at the top and value-oriented improvements at the entry level—is expanding the category’s reach and reinforcing gaming monitors as a high-spec companion to native notebook PC displays.
Gaming monitor shipments are projected to expand to 43 million units in 2026, supported by increased cost-effectiveness and added functionality. Omdia expects the desktop monitor market to intensify activity, particularly within gaming, as the future becomes more closely tied to premium display technologies.
Esports growth is contributing to a performance-first ecosystem, concentrating demand on 240–360 Hz gaming monitors with 1ms or lower response times as pro players prioritize competitive advantage over price.
Adoption is also linked to price-to-performance for 27-inch, 240Hz QHD (1440p) OLED models with a 0.03ms response time, which have gained traction as prices drop. Omdia said advanced panel technologies such as OLED and QD-OLED are capturing significant market share.
Dual-mode gaming monitors are also growing in popularity because they reduce the trade-off for players who split time between fast-paced competitive shooters and high-fidelity cinematic titles. These monitors allow users to toggle between high-resolution and high-refresh-rate modes—for example, 4K at 240 Hz and 1080p at 480 Hz.
Omdia said dual-mode models can outperform traditional scaling by using hardware integer scaling to preserve sharpness at lower resolutions, while integrated AI supports real-time image optimization and automatic brightness adjustment. The firm expects dual-mode gaming monitors to grow by double digits in 2026, reflecting both upgrade cycles and future-proofing.
Despite strong demand trends, several factors may limit broader market penetration. High manufacturing costs for OLED panels can make high-end monitors less accessible to budget-conscious consumers, and OLED burn-in concerns persist despite improvements. In addition, supply chain and material volatility—linked to semiconductor shortages and geopolitical tensions—can disrupt production schedules and increase costs, adding uncertainty for the industry.
